Main features and details

The framework for responsible gambling in Australia includes several important components. Firstly, self-exclusion programs allow players to voluntarily ban themselves from gambling platforms for a specified period. This feature is crucial for individuals who recognize their gambling habits may be problematic. Secondly, many online casinos offer tools that enable players to set limits on their deposits, losses, and wagering amounts. These tools empower players to take control of their gambling activities and promote a healthier relationship with gambling. Additionally, educational resources are provided by various organizations to inform players about the risks associated with gambling and how to gamble responsibly.

Advantages and disadvantages

There are several advantages to implementing responsible gambling practices. Firstly, these measures help protect vulnerable players from developing gambling-related issues, fostering a safer gambling environment. Secondly, they enhance the reputation of online casinos, as players are more likely to engage with platforms that prioritize their well-being. However, there are also disadvantages to consider. Some players may feel that restrictions limit their freedom to gamble as they wish, potentially leading to frustration. Additionally, the effectiveness of these measures relies heavily on player awareness and willingness to utilize the tools available to them.
